Description
Public school pupil participation on certain teams and in certain clubs; parental consent and notification. Provides that the prior written consent of the parent of a public school pupil is required for the pupil to participate on any school-sponsored athletic or academic team or in any extracurricular club that meets before, during, or after regular school hours and that either is officially recognized by the school or meets on school property. The bill requires the school to notify any such parent of any such pupil when the pupil participates on any such team or in any such club without the required prior written consent of the parent.
